Videos of speaking in tongues often depict individuals in religious settings expressing their faith through what they believe to be a divine language. This practice, known as glossolalia, is common in various Christian denominations, particularly in Pentecostal and charismatic movements. These videos may showcase passionate worship, emotional experiences, and communal prayer, often eliciting mixed reactions from viewers regarding authenticity and interpretation. While many participants find it spiritually uplifting, critics may view it as a psychological or performative phenomenon.
